Ingredients
- Chicken breasts: 4 boneless skinless (about 680 g / 1.5 lb)
- Chickpeas: 1 can (400 g / 15 oz) drained and rinsed
- Olive oil: 2 tbsp
- Garlic cloves: 3 minced
- Yellow onion: 1 small finely chopped
- Chicken broth: 1 cup (240 ml) low-sodium
- Heavy cream: 1/2 cup (120 ml)
- Sun-dried tomatoes: 1/3 cup (60 g) chopped packed in oil drained
- Parmesan cheese: 1/4 cup (25 g) grated
- Dried oregano: 1 tsp
- Dried thyme: 1/2 tsp
- Red pepper flakes: 1/2 tsp optional
- Salt: 1/2 tsp or to taste
- Black pepper: 1/4 tsp
- Basil or parsley: 2 tbsp chopped fresh optional
Instructions
- Step 1:
- Pat the chicken breasts dry and season both sides with salt and pepper.
- Step 2:
-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Sear chicken breasts for 3 4 minutes per side until golden brown. Remove to a plate.
- Step 3:
- In the same skillet add onion and sauté for 2 3 minutes until translucent. Add garlic and cook for 30 seconds stirring.
- Step 4:
- Stir in sun-dried tomatoes oregano thyme and red pepper flakes. Cook for 1 minute.
- Step 5:
- Pour in chicken broth and scrape up any browned bits from the pan. Stir in heavy cream and Parmesan cheese until well combined.
- Step 6:
- Return chicken breasts to the skillet. Add chickpeas nestling them around the chicken.
- Step 7:
- Simmer uncovered for 10 12 minutes or until chicken is cooked through (internal temp 74°C / 165°F) and sauce is slightly thickened.
- Step 8:
- Taste and adjust seasoning if needed. Garnish with fresh basil or parsley before serving.

Allergen Information
Contains dairy heavy cream Parmesan cheese and chickpeas legume. Gluten-free if all ingredients are certified gluten-free.
Nutritional Information
Calories 450 Total Fat 20 g Carbohydrates 22 g Protein 44 g per serving.

Recipe Questions & Answers
- → What makes this chicken dish high in protein?
The combination of lean chicken breasts and protein-packed chickpeas provides a substantial amount of protein per serving.
- → Can I substitute the chickpeas with other legumes?
Yes, white beans or cannellini beans can be used as alternatives for a similar texture and flavor profile.
- → How do the sun-dried tomatoes affect the flavor?
Sun-dried tomatoes add a rich, tangy sweetness that complements the creamy sauce and savory chicken.
- → Is this dish suitable for gluten-free diets?
All ingredients are naturally gluten-free, but be sure to verify labels to avoid cross-contamination.
- → What side dishes pair well with this meal?
Steamed vegetables, brown rice, or a fresh green salad provide balanced accompaniments to the creamy chicken.
- → Can I lighten the dish by altering the sauce?
Using half-and-half or low-fat cream instead of heavy cream will reduce the richness while maintaining creaminess.
